Merge pull request #10168 from gilles-peskine-arm/union-initialization-gcc15-basic-fix-3.6
Backport 3.6: Fix insufficient union initialization in contexts
diff --git a/ChangeLog.d/union-initialization.txt b/ChangeLog.d/union-initialization.txt
new file mode 100644
index 0000000..a63e1eb
--- /dev/null
+++ b/ChangeLog.d/union-initialization.txt
@@ -0,0 +1,15 @@
+Bugfix
+ * Fix failures of PSA multipart or interruptible operations when the
+ library or the application is built with a compiler where
+ "union foo x = {0}" does not initialize non-default members of the
+ union, such as GCC 15 and some versions of Clang 18. This affected MAC
+ multipart operations, MAC-based key derivation operations, interruptible
+ signature, interruptible verification, and potentially other operations
+ when using third-party drivers. This also affected one-shot MAC
+ operations using the built-in implementation. Fixes #9814.
+ * On entry to PSA driver entry points that set up a multipart operation
+ ("xxx_setup"), the operation object is supposed to be all-bits-zero.
+ This was sometimes not the case when an operation object is reused,
+ or with compilers where "union foo x = {0}" does not initialize
+ non-default members of the union. The PSA core now ensures that this
+ guarantee is met in all cases. Fixes #9975.

+ /* Make sure the whole the operation is zeroed.
+ * It isn't enough to require the caller to initialize operation to
+ * PSA_MAC_OPERATION_INIT, since one field is a union and initializing
+ * a union does not necessarily initialize all of its members.
+ * psa_mac_setup() would handle PSA_MAC_OPERATION_INIT, but here we
+ * bypass it and call lower-level functions directly. */
+ memset(operation, 0, sizeof(*operation));
+
operation->is_sign = 1;
operation->mac_size = PSA_HASH_LENGTH(hash_alg);
